eHealth, Privacy & Security
The eHealth, Privacy & Security Interest Group focuses on cutting edge issues dealing with technology and privacy as they relate to healthcare. Substantive topics of interest to committee members include health information privacy and security, electronic communications, electronic transactions and telehealth. The Interest Group will seek to encourage discussion and debate on emerging legal issues in these areas.
